Brief description The process in which a relatively unspecialized cell acquires specialized features of a neuron located in the hypothalamus. These neurons release gonadotrophin-releasing hormone as a neural transmitter. [GO_REF:0000021, GOC:cls, GOC:dgh, GOC:dph, GOC:jid, PMID:12626695]
